Art 101 Questions And Correct Answers By Expert
The vocabulary of art includes ________________________________; these are the
visual or plastic elements. Right Ans - line, shape, light, value, color, texture,
space, time, and motion
A Bronze sculpture occupies three-dimensional space and has measurable
volume and weight. So it has ________________ . Right Ans - actual mass
The fresco The School of Athens uses ____________________ a system for depicting
the depth, in which parallel lines receding into the distance converge at a
point on the horizon line known as the vanishing point. Forms get smaller in
proportion to the receding lines. Right Ans - linear perspective
_______________ is the organization of the visual elements in a work of art.
Right Ans - Composition
If a vertical axis were drawn through the center of the work, the two halves of
the central figures and the geometric motifs and animal motifs extending to
the sides would be exact mirror images balancing each other. This work has
____________________. Right Ans - bilateral symmetry
In the visual arts, ______________ refers to a distinctive handling of elements and
media associated with the work of an individual artist, a school or movement,
or specific culture or time period. Right Ans - style
Judy flaps voodoo is a ______________ work of art. The highly saturated colors
and jagged shapes comprise the content and the spirit of the work with no
references to make sure our reality. Right Ans - abstract art
From the statements below which is not an example of formalist criticism for
the work Sketch I for Composition VII? Right Ans - There is a predominant
red color throughout the work that is repeated in varying quantities and is
occasionally complemented by green.
There are three levels of ____________ subject matter, elements and composition,
and underlying or symbolic meaning or themes. Right Ans - form
, ___________ are abrasive and scratch the surface of the support, leaving particles
of the material being used where they come into contact with the support.
They include the mediums of silverpoint, pencil, charcoal, chalk, crayon, and
pastel. Right Ans - dry media
________ is an oil painting technique in which oil paint is applied so thickly that
it can physically construct the image. It is any thick application of paint in
which the strokes of the brush or palette knife are recorded as an actual
texture on the surface of the paint. Right Ans - impasto
__________ is any printmaking technique in which the printing plate or matrix is
carved with carving tools so that the areas that are not meant to be printed
(that is, that are not meant to leave an image) are below the surface of the
matrix. The image is printed from the remaining raised surface. Right Ans -
Relief
A major step in the history of photography came with the introduction by
Louis Lumiere of the ______________ color process in 1907. Right Ans -
autochrome
__________________ revolutionized the capacity of news media, with the ability to
bring realistic representation of important events before the public's eyes.
Right Ans - photography
With the introduction of the camera, ____________ synergistically moved toward
abstraction because the obligation to faithfully record nature was now
assumed by the photographer. Right Ans - painters
___________ are constructed by placing barrel vaults at right angles to cover a
square space known as a ______. Right Ans - groin vaults; bay
The ______ is an architectural structure generally in the shape of a hemisphere
or a half globe and is commonly defined as an arch rotated 360 degrees.
Right Ans - dome
